Mike Macdonald, Sam Darnold, and Kenneth Walker III just led the Seattle Seahawks to a 29-13 win in Super Bowl LX. It was the second Super Bowl win in the Seahawks’ franchise history. Now, the team is expected to be put up for sale.
For now, the team is owned by Jody Allen after her brother Paul passed away back in 2018. Paul’s estate mandated that the Seahawks be sold after his death. Now, the wheels are expected to be put back in motion.
But how much are the Seahawks worth? Probably a lot more than you think.
According to Mike Florio of Pro Football Talk, “it’s currently believed that the high bidder will land in the range of $9 billion to $11 million.”
If so, that would set a new mark for the most expensive sale in NFL history. The previous and current high was set by Josh Harris, who purchased the Washington Commanders for $6.05 billion in 2023.
NFL teams rarely go up for sale, and the opportunity to purchase a winning team will surely attract bidders from all over the world. Amazon founder Jeff Bezos has frequently been linked to becoming an NFL team owner; he even has previous ties to Seattle. But it could be any billionaire with an interest in making a large investment, not just someone like Bezos.
